WebHikers and horseback riders are welcome to enjoy over 20 miles of scenic, rocky, and occasionally steep trails in the Hereford area. Please stay on designated trails; this area is designated by the Maryland General Assembly as a State Wildlands for its unique wilderness character and ecological value. Bicycles are strictly prohibited.
